BIRTHDAY PARTIES NO LONGER CANCELLED THIS YEAR, THANKS TO AFL MAX!

AFL Max, Australia’s first football skills and family entertainment venue, is well versed in hosting kid’s birthday parties. However, the temporary closure of the venue has forced many kids and families to postpone their celebrations. Like many businesses, AFL Max has been working on creative ways to adapt their services, by taking them online. Forced to think differently, AFL Max has developed and is set to launch Virtual Birthday Parties.

AFL Max Virtual Parties will enable kids to connect with their friends online and enjoy their birthday party from the safety of their own home. Kids can even invite AFL Players to their birthday party.

The 100% online party platform connects the party guests online, with a dedicated AFL Max party host in each party. With their host, the kids will be guided through a range of activities, combining physical and mental challenges, games and quizzes. AFL Players can also be invited to join the party for a Q+A session, sing Happy Birthday with the group – or send through a personalized video message for the birthday child.

James Podsiadly, Managing Director of AFL Max said, “We believe no kid should have to miss out on their birthday party, no matter the environment.” The Ex-AFL Player’s vision, when creating AFL Max, was to build a safe and interactive venue where all people feel welcome, which is what he hopes the Virtual Parties will continue to offer AFL Max fans, while the venue is closed.

“We want kids to still be kids! We want to help them stay connected with one another and celebrate their birthdays together!

“We also want to give them their footy fix, which is why we’re excited to offer the opportunity for kids to invite AFL Players to their parties.” he said.

The Virtual Parties also aim to give parents a break, while the kids enjoy time online with their friends, facilitated by an experienced AFL Max party host, “We’re excited to give both kids and parents something to look forward to, given the unprecedented amounts of time being spent at home, together!” he said.
